Dubai Duty Free donates Dh2m to Autism Centre

Money will be used to build new premises in Garhoud

Dubai: Dubai Duty Free (DDF) donated Dh2 million to the Dubai Autism Centre to construct a new premises in Garhoud.

The Autism Centre’s new premises will cover 91,000 square feet and be able to accommodate 200 students. It will include a gymnasium, swimming pool and library.

Colm McLoughlin, DDF executive vice-chairman said: “As part of the company’s continued corporate social responsibility, we believed that it is our role to support the communities from which we operate. We are delighted to be a part in the building of a new facility to further enhance the works of Dubai Autism Centre who made great effort in providing autistic children and their families with support and guidance.”
